1. nftables supports NPTv6 (Network Prefix Translation), which is similar to NAT, except it's stateless and every device remains individually addressable. So you can configure your DHCPv6/SLAAC to assign to each device both an address from your globally-routable prefix and from your ULA prefix, and then NPTv6 will handle mapping your ULA prefix to/from the internet. 2. Lots of ISPs only assign a /64 by default, but if you configure your router to request a /56 via DHCPv6 prefix delegation, you'll usually get the larger prefix. FWIW, I'm using both of these on my home network, via a router running OpenWRT. |

When I was reading up on everything, I also learned that your router can request a bigger prefix, but I ran across several posts from various folks stating they could only get a /64 from Comcast no matter what they tried, so I'm not sure how universally supported DHCPv6-PD requests are.
